Eibach Wheel Spacers, safe for roadcourse?

Hi,

So I have a set of 18X10.5 Z06 wheels in the rear running 295's and im getting a some rubbage on the inside of the wheel well. I wanted to know if by using these wheel spacer (20mm) It would be safe and a wheel wouldnt go flying off.

I noticed this on a track day when i was doing about 70-80mph going into turns. Knowing this i put back on the stock 9" wide wheels and 275 width tires and didnt have a problem. I figured that wider is better for more grip when going around turns.
